Is there any way to expose the relative or absolute coordinates of a CoreWebView2Frame in WebView2?
CoreWebView2Frame
I need to position a .Net dialog over an element, which is fine in a top level frame, but not if the element is in a frame.
Not easy to use JS as the frames may not be from the same source, so won't easily be able get the location of the iFrame.
